This quick and easy semi-homemade Waffle Ice Cream Sandwich recipe is perfect for hot summer days! Younger children who like to help out in the kitchen will have a blast helping create their own desserts.
Pre-heat oven to 350ºF and arrange the waffles on a large, rimmed baking sheet. Remove ice cream from freezer to begin to soften slightly.
4 Square Waffles, Vanilla Bean Ice Cream
Place baking sheet in pre-heated oven and bake for 10-12 minutes, flipping the waffles halfway through.
4 Square Waffles
Once the waffles are golden brown, remove baking sheet from the oven and set aside to cool for several minutes.
4 Square Waffles
Prepare the chocolate syrup by combining the water, sugar, cocoa powder, vanilla extract, and salt in a small skillet set over medium heat. Whisk vigorously until the sugar is dissolved and the cocoa powder is thoroughly incorporated into the mixture, approximately 2-3 minutes. Remove from heat and cool completely.
1/2 c Water, 1/2 c White Sugar, 1/3 c Unsweetened Dark Cocoa Powder, 1 t Real Vanilla Extract, 1/8 t Salt
Add a scoop of ice cream to four of the waffles and spread into an even layer. Top each with one of the remaining toasted waffles to create a “sandwich.”
Vanilla Bean Ice Cream, 4 Square Waffles
Place the ice cream sandwiches back on the baking tray and place in the freeze for 30 minutes to firm up. Remove baking sheet from freezer and top with the chocolate sauce, plus sprinkles and/or chopped nuts, if desired, before serving. Enjoy!
